Text To Speech Software For Interactive Audio Content: A Comprehensive Overview

Imagine being able to transform any written content into engaging and interactive audio with just a few clicks. With Text to Speech software, this is now possible. In this comprehensive overview, you will explore the endless possibilities of using Text to Speech software for creating dynamic audio content. From enhancing podcasts and audiobooks to revolutionizing e-learning platforms and game narratives, this technology opens up new avenues for captivating storytelling. Discover how Text to Speech software can transform your written words into an immersive audio experience that captivates and engages your audience like never before.

Introduction

Welcome to this comprehensive article on text-to-speech (TTS) software! In today’s world, where technology is rapidly advancing, text-to-speech software has become an invaluable tool for various applications. Whether it’s making content more accessible, enhancing educational experiences, or improving customer support, TTS software offers countless benefits. In this article, we will explore what TTS software is, its history, its advantages and limitations, popular software options, considerations when choosing the right one, implementing it in interactive audio content, future developments, and various challenges. So, let’s dive in!

What is Text to Speech (TTS) Software?

Definition

Text-to-speech software, as the name suggests, is a technology that converts written text into spoken words. It uses advanced algorithms and natural language processing to generate human-like voices that can accurately articulate the text. By transforming written content into spoken words, TTS software allows accessibility to information and a more immersive audio experience.

History

The origins of TTS software can be traced back to the 1960s when researchers began exploring the possibilities of computer-generated speech. Initially, the speech produced by early TTS systems was robotic and lacked natural intonation. However, with advancements in technology, including artificial intelligence and neural networks, TTS software has made significant strides towards producing more realistic and human-like voices.

Benefits

Text-to-speech software offers a range of benefits across different domains. One of its key advantages is improving accessibility and inclusion for individuals with visual impairments or reading difficulties. TTS software allows information to be presented audibly, enabling users to consume content without relying solely on written text.

In educational settings, TTS software plays a vital role in e-learning and educational content. It can read out textbooks, online articles, or study notes, helping students with comprehension, language learning, and even pronunciation. Additionally, TTS software can be used to create audiobooks, making literature more accessible to individuals with different reading preferences.

TTS software also has numerous applications in multimedia and entertainment. It can be used in video games, virtual reality experiences, and animations to provide voiceovers for characters and narrations, enhancing the overall immersion and engagement for the users.

Moreover, in the realm of customer support and virtual assistants, TTS software is widely used to provide realistic and human-like voices for interactive chatbots and voice assistants. This enables companies to provide efficient and personalized customer service experiences.

Limitations

While text-to-speech software has many advantages, it is not without its limitations. The quality of voices generated by TTS software can vary, and some may still sound somewhat robotic or unnatural. However, this is an area where significant advancements are being made to enhance the naturalness of the voices produced.

Another limitation is the pronunciation accuracy, especially for less common or specialized terms. TTS software may struggle with correctly pronouncing certain words or names, which can potentially impact the comprehension of the content.

It is also important to note that different TTS software options may offer different language support and voice options. Some software may have limitations in terms of available languages or voice selection. Therefore, it is crucial to consider these limitations when choosing the right TTS software for your specific needs.

Text To Speech Software For Interactive Audio Content: A Comprehensive Overview

Applications of Text to Speech Software

Accessibility and Inclusion

One of the primary applications of TTS software is in improving accessibility and inclusion. By converting written text into spoken words, TTS software enables individuals with visual impairments or reading difficulties to access information more effectively. Websites, documents, and other digital materials can be made accessible by integrating TTS software, ensuring that nobody is left behind when it comes to accessing and consuming information.

E-Learning and Educational Content

TTS software has revolutionized the world of e-learning and educational content. By reading out textbooks, study notes, or online articles, TTS software facilitates better comprehension, enhances language learning, and improves pronunciation for students. It also enables the creation of audiobooks, making literature more accessible and appealing to a wider audience.

Multimedia and Entertainment

In the realm of multimedia and entertainment, TTS software contributes to creating more immersive and engaging experiences. By generating voices for characters in video games, virtual reality experiences, or animations, TTS software enhances the storytelling aspect and adds a new dimension to the overall user experience. It also allows for the creation of personalized character voices for interactive content.

Customer Support and Virtual Assistants

TTS software plays a crucial role in customer support and virtual assistants by providing realistic and human-like voices for interactive chatbots and voice assistants. This helps companies deliver efficient and personalized customer service experiences, enabling users to have natural conversations and receive assistance for their queries and concerns.

Features of Text to Speech Software

Voice Selection

A significant feature of TTS software is the ability to choose from a wide range of voices. Users can select voices based on gender, age, accent, or even different fictional characters. This flexibility allows content creators to personalize and tailor the audio experience to suit their specific needs and preferences.

Pronunciation Customization

Another essential feature of TTS software is the ability to customize pronunciations. While TTS software generally does a good job of pronouncing most words accurately, there may be instances where specific terms or names need customization. Pronunciation guides and phonetic dictionaries can be used to fine-tune the software’s pronunciation capabilities, ensuring more accurate and intelligible speech.

Emotional Tones and Intonation

TTS software has advanced to the point where it can now generate emotional tones and intonation. This enables the voices to convey different emotions, such as happiness, sadness, excitement, or anger, in a more expressive and realistic manner. By leveraging emotional tones and intonation, content creators can evoke specific emotions in the audience, further enhancing the overall audio experience.

Multilingual Capabilities

Many TTS software options offer multilingual capabilities, allowing users to generate speech in different languages. This feature is particularly beneficial for global companies or educational institutions that cater to a diverse audience. It enables content to be created and delivered in multiple languages, ensuring effective communication and understanding across various cultures.

Text To Speech Software For Interactive Audio Content: A Comprehensive Overview

Popular Text to Speech Software

There are several popular text-to-speech software options available in the market. Let’s take a closer look at some of them:

Google Text-to-Speech

Google Text-to-Speech is a widely used TTS software offered by Google. It integrates seamlessly with various Google applications and services, providing high-quality voice synthesis in multiple languages. It also offers a wide range of voice options to choose from, allowing users to customize the audio experience.

Amazon Polly

Amazon Polly, developed by Amazon Web Services, is a powerful TTS software solution. It offers natural-sounding voices and supports multiple languages. With its robust API and cloud-based infrastructure, Amazon Polly is a versatile choice for implementing TTS in a range of applications, from e-learning platforms to customer support systems.

IBM Watson Text to Speech

IBM Watson Text to Speech is part of the IBM Watson AI platform. It provides advanced TTS capabilities, including expressive and emotional voices. It offers support for multiple languages and allows for customization of pronunciation and intonation. IBM Watson Text to Speech is widely used in industries such as healthcare, finance, and customer service.

Microsoft Azure Text to Speech

Microsoft Azure Text to Speech is a comprehensive TTS solution offered by Microsoft. It boasts a wide range of high-quality voices in various languages. With its user-friendly API and integration options, Microsoft Azure Text to Speech is a popular choice for developers and content creators looking to incorporate TTS into their applications and services.

Nuance Communications

Nuance Communications is a leading provider of speech and imaging solutions. They offer TTS software that delivers natural-sounding voices with great clarity. Nuance Communications’ TTS solutions are widely used in industries such as automotive, healthcare, and call centers, where high-quality voice output is critical.

NaturalReader

NaturalReader is a user-friendly TTS software that offers a variety of voices and supports multiple languages. It provides a seamless reading experience with its intuitive interface and easy integration options. NaturalReader is popular among students, professionals, and individuals with reading difficulties who require accessible and customized audio content.

iSpeech

iSpeech is a cloud-based TTS software that offers a range of voices and customization options. It provides support for multiple languages and allows for real-time speech synthesis. iSpeech is commonly used in applications such as mobile devices, automotive systems, and assistive technology.

ReadSpeaker

ReadSpeaker is a well-established TTS software provider known for its high-quality voices and multilingual capabilities. It offers seamless integration with various platforms and applications and caters to a wide range of industries, including education, government, and media.

TextAloud

TextAloud is a TTS software that focuses on providing natural-sounding voices with customizable options. It allows users to convert text into audio files that can be saved and played back anytime. TextAloud is popular among individuals who want to listen to articles, ebooks, or documents on the go.

VoiceDream

VoiceDream is a TTS software specifically designed for mobile devices. It offers a range of voices and supports various file formats. VoiceDream’s user-friendly interface and accessibility features make it a preferred choice for individuals with visual impairments or learning disabilities.

Choosing the Right Text to Speech Software

When selecting a text-to-speech software, it is essential to consider several factors. Here are some key considerations:

Compatibility and Integration

Ensure that the TTS software is compatible with the platforms, operating systems, and applications you plan to use it with. Seamless integration with your existing infrastructure is crucial to maximize its benefits without any technical constraints.

Quality of Voices

Evaluate the quality and naturalness of the voices offered by the TTS software. Opt for software that produces human-like voices with good intonation and clarity. Many providers offer voice samples for testing, allowing you to assess the quality before making a decision.

Language Support

Consider the language support offered by the TTS software. Ensure that it supports the languages you require, especially if you cater to a diverse audience. Some software may have limitations in terms of language availability, so it is important to choose one that meets your specific needs.

Pricing and Licensing

Consider the pricing models and licensing terms offered by the TTS software providers. Some software may have subscription-based pricing, while others may follow a pay-per-use model. Assess your budget and choose a software option that aligns with your financial resources and requirements.

Implementing Text to Speech in Interactive Audio Content

The versatility of text-to-speech software allows for its integration in various interactive audio content. Here are some examples of how TTS can be implemented:

Adding TTS to Websites and Applications

TTS can be integrated into websites, applications, and digital platforms to provide audio versions of written content. By enabling users to listen to articles, blog posts, or webpages, TTS enhances accessibility and inclusivity. It also provides an alternative way to consume information, catering to users’ reading preferences.

Creating Interactive Audiobooks

Text-to-speech software enables the creation of interactive audiobooks. By converting written text into speech, the software brings the characters and the story to life, providing an engaging audio experience. TTS software can also enhance the reading experience by highlighting the text being spoken, facilitating understanding and comprehension.

Enhancing Virtual Reality and Gaming Experiences

In the realm of virtual reality and gaming, TTS software is utilized to enhance the immersion and interactivity of the experiences. By providing realistic and dynamic voices for characters and narrations, TTS software enriches the audio aspect of the virtual worlds and gaming environments. This enhances the overall user engagement and makes the experiences more captivating.

Integrating TTS in Chatbots and Voice Assistants

TTS software is commonly used in chatbots and voice assistants to deliver human-like and interactive conversations. By generating natural-sounding voices, TTS software ensures that the user interactions feel more conversational and engaging. This technology enables companies to deliver efficient and personalized customer service experiences through virtual agents.

Future Developments and Trends

Text-to-speech software is an evolving field, and several developments and trends are shaping its future. Let’s explore some of the exciting possibilities:

Artificial Intelligence and Neural Networks

With advancements in artificial intelligence and neural networks, TTS software is becoming smarter and more capable of producing natural-sounding voices. AI-powered TTS models are continuously improving and learning from vast amounts of data, resulting in more realistic speech synthesis.

Voice Cloning and Personalization

Voice cloning enables users to create personalized voices for characters or their own voice. By training the TTS software with specific voice samples, it is possible to generate a voice that closely resembles an individual’s unique vocal characteristics. This opens up possibilities for more personalized and customized audio content creation.

Real-time Adaptive TTS

Real-time adaptive TTS is an emerging trend that involves dynamically adjusting the generated voice based on the context, user preferences, or real-time feedback. This allows for more flexible and natural-sounding speeches that can adapt to different scenarios and preferences, enhancing the overall listening experience.

Enhanced Emotional Expression

TTS software is being developed to offer enhanced emotional expression, allowing voices to convey a broader range of emotions. By incorporating intonations, pauses, and other speech elements, TTS software can evoke specific emotional responses in the listeners, making the audio content more engaging and immersive.

Considerations and Challenges

While text-to-speech software offers numerous possibilities, there are considerations and challenges to be aware of:

Naturalness and Intelligibility

Despite advancements in TTS technology, achieving perfect naturalness and intelligibility in generated voices is still a challenge. TTS software may sometimes produce robotic or unnatural-sounding speech, impacting the overall listening experience. Continued research and development are focused on addressing these challenges to provide more authentic voices.

Privacy and Security

As TTS software relies on processing and analyzing written text, privacy and security concerns arise. It is crucial to ensure that sensitive information shared through TTS systems is protected and that privacy policies and protocols are in place to safeguard user data.

Copyright and Ownership

When using TTS software, it is important to respect copyright laws and ownership rights. Ensure that you have the necessary permissions and licenses to convert written content into speech, especially when dealing with copyrighted materials or proprietary content.

Ethical Use of TTS

The ethical use of TTS software involves being mindful of the impact it may have on individuals and society. It is essential to consider the potential misuse or manipulation of TTS-generated voices and content and to adhere to ethical guidelines and standards when incorporating TTS technology into interactive audio content.

Conclusion

In conclusion, text-to-speech software has become an essential tool for creating interactive audio content across various domains. From improving accessibility and inclusivity to enhancing educational experiences and customer support, TTS software offers a range of benefits. With features like voice selection, pronunciation customization, emotional tones, and multilingual capabilities, TTS software provides flexibility and customization options. While there are limitations and challenges, continuous advancements in the field promise a future with more natural-sounding voices, personalized audio experiences, and enhanced emotional expression. By considering the various factors and selecting the right TTS software, content creators can effectively integrate TTS into their interactive audio content, ensuring a more engaging and inclusive experience for their audience.